My Car: 2008 Prius Package: #2 Nominated 0 Times in 0 Posts TOTM Awards: 0 Friends: 0 | i payed 275 installed with tax. It integrates with your stock stereo. If you get it professionally installed they may say it only uses one speaker, but you can wire so it uses all four speakers. It mutes the music when you have an incoming or outgoing call. I currently have it setup where it uses only the front two speaker so i have have music streamin in the back. It's not bad, but it's more of a personal preference. Have the speakers play in the back isn't all that loud and it doesn't seem like anyone is bothered by the music when i'm talking to someone. again.. if you have a treo... this is the best integrated bluethooth headset out there.
